Lets Talk Turkey
A Consumer Guide to Safely Roasting a Turkey Fresh or Frozen? Fresh Turkeys Allow 1 pound of turkey per person. Buy your turkey only 1 to 2 days before you plan to cook it. Keep it stored in the refrigerator until you’re ready to cook it. Place it on a tray or in a pan […]